If you haven't read TC's new article "Are the Texans toast? KC Joyner talks cornerbacks", you should. It has TC's usual good coverage of the Texans but the part I like the best comes at the end when she gives her observation/insight into the Texans' OTAs:

"Interesting, from my observation of OTAs, safety Bernard Pollard has assumed the role of leader of the secondary now that Dunta Robinson is gone. First in line with each drill, and doing his practice with authority (he makes you feel sorry for tackling sleds).

And well, this is hard to explain, but he growls a lot. He makes growling dog noises. Almost like he is alpha dog keeping the pups in check. It's a bit peculiar but if it works, I don't care."

Sounds like he's taking Dunta's and Alex Gibbs place at the same time.

I was always a Dunta fan... Even after the holdout last off-season, I liked the idea of potentially franchising him again after the '09 season. But, after watching the '09 season, it became very clear that he simply isn't any good (I think he was before the injury- at times). So, I'm actually very excited about the secondary play this year. I think we have a good shot at much improved DB play with the group being brought in and the addition by subtraction of Dunta. I think a healthy Pollard is crucial, though.
